fix(gui): Force newline in discussion entries to prevent squashed layout
- Insert imgui.new_line() before rendering discussion content. - Ensures the Markdown renderer inherits the full horizontal width of the panel. - Definitively fixes vertical squashing of tables and long text blocks.
